Class BaseProfitBricksResponseHandler<T>

All Implemented Interfaces:
InvocationContext<ParseSax.HandlerWithResult<T>>, ContentHandler, DTDHandler, EntityResolver, ErrorHandler
Direct Known Subclasses:
BaseDataCenterResponseHandler, BaseFirewallResponseHandler, BaseFirewallRuleResponseHandler, BaseImageResponseHandler, BaseIpBlockResponseHandler, BaseLoadBalancerResponseHandler, BaseNicResponseHandler, BasePublicIpResponseHandler, BaseServerResponseHandler, BaseSnapshotResponseHandler, BaseStorageResponseHandler, GetProvisioningStateResponseHandler, LoadBalancerIdOnlyResponseHandler, NicIdOnlyResponseHandler, RequestIdOnlyResponseHandler, ServerIdOnlyResponseHandler, ServiceFaultResponseHandler, StorageIdOnlyResponseHandler

public abstract class BaseProfitBricksResponseHandler<T> extends ParseSax.HandlerForGeneratedRequestWithResult<T>
  • Constructor Details

    • BaseProfitBricksResponseHandler

      public BaseProfitBricksResponseHandler()
  • Method Details

    • characters

      public void characters(char[] ch, int start, int length)
      Specified by:
      characters in interface ContentHandler
      Overrides:
      characters in class DefaultHandler
    • textToStringValue

      protected String textToStringValue()
    • textToFloatValue

      protected Float textToFloatValue()
    • textToDoubleValue

      protected Double textToDoubleValue()
    • textToIntValue

      protected int textToIntValue()
    • textToBooleanValue

      protected boolean textToBooleanValue()
    • clearTextBuffer

      protected void clearTextBuffer()
    • reset

      public void reset()
    • endElement

      public abstract void endElement(String uri, String localName, String qName) throws SAXException
      Specified by:
      endElement in interface ContentHandler
      Overrides:
      endElement in class DefaultHandler
      Throws:
      SAXException
    • setPropertyOnEndTag

      protected abstract void setPropertyOnEndTag(String qName)